

The image shows a pencil drawing of a lighthouse. The lighthouse is made of bricks and has a conical roof with a small window at the top. A weather vane sits atop the roof. The lighthouse has a small door and a single window on its side. The lighthouse sits on a brick platform that is curved on the right side. The platform is made up of bricks that are drawn in a pattern to show their texture. The background of the image is a light brown color, resembling aged paper. The words "Buffalo Lighthouse" are written in cursive at the bottom of the image.
